Property Law- The Transfer of Property Act came into existence in 1882. Before that, the transfer of immovable property was governed by the principles of English law and equity. This Act deals with the transfer of property inter vivos, i.e., a transfer between living persons. The Property Law of the People's Republic of China (Chinese: 《中华人民共和国物权法》; pinyin: Zhōnghuá Rénmín Gònghéguó Wùquán Fǎ) is a property law adopted by the National People's Congress in 2007 (on March 16) that went into effect on October 1, 2007.
